CHICAGO -- Tensions continue to run high at college campuses across the country as students protest Israel 's war in Gaza. On Sunday, clashes erupted at DePaul as pro-Palestinian protesters were met with counter-pro- Israel protesters. At one point, school administrators called Chicago Police to intervene. Demonstrators, who have been mostly peaceful at the encampment they set up six days ago at the quad, were confronted by a group of pro- Israel i protesters.
Officers lined up between the two groups, and some of the pro-Israel protesters spilled into the street, obstructing traffic. At the time, the university issued an alert urging students to avoid the area and to remain inside their buildings. Later the school posted on its 'X' account that students can leave their buildings after being alerted to remain indoors but to avoid the Quad and Fullerton when leaving the Richardson Library, SAC, McGowan North/South, and University Hall.
